When Do You Need Residential Re Roofing?
You may find yourself wondering if it's the right time for residential re roofing? Consider these signs:
- Visible Damage: Look out for cracked or missing shingles.
- Leaks: Water stains on ceilings often indicate roof damage.
- Age: Most roofs need replacement after 20-25 years.
- Moss Growth: Excessive growth on the roof could mean moisture retention.

Types of Roofing Materials Used in Residential Re Roofing
Choosing the right material is essential for achieving durability and style during residential re roofing projects. Here are popular options available in Auckland:
Steel Roofing
Steel roofs have surged in popularity due to their strength and longevity.
- Durability: Can last over 50 years without serious upkeep.
- Weather Resistant: Ideal for Auckland’s erratic weather patterns.
- Eco-Friendly: Many steel options are made from recycled materials.
Asphalt Shingles
Asphalt shingles remain a classic choice among homeowners due to their affordability.
- Versatility: Available in various colors and styles.
- Cost-effective: They are one of the more budget-friendly options.
Tile Roofing
Tile roofs bring timeless beauty but come with additional considerations.
- Longevity: Tiles can last up to a century!
- Weight: Ensure your house’s structure supports tile weight.
The Residential Re Roofing Process Explained
To fully appreciate residential re roofing, it's important to understand how the process unfolds step-by-step:
-
Inspection
- A professional team inspects your existing roof for damages and assesses whether a complete replacement is necessary or if repairs will suffice.
-
Planning & Design
- If required, discussions around aesthetic preferences and materials begin here, taking into consideration architectural compatibility with your home style.
-
Removal
- Once designs are approved, old materials must be stripped away carefully, creating a clean surface for installation.
-
Installation
- New materials—whether they be steel panels, asphalt shingles, or tiles—are skillfully applied according to manufacturer guidelines ensuring optimal performance.
-
Final Inspection
- Post-installation checks will confirm that everything meets safety standards before completion officially closes out the project.
FAQs About Residential Re Roofing
How long does residential re roofing take?
Typically, depending on factors such as house size and type of new material being applied, it can take anywhere from several days to two weeks for completion.
Is there any preparation needed before starting a residential re roofing project?
Yes! You may need remove outdoor furniture or cover plants vulnerable during installation.
Do I need permits for residential re roofing?
In Auckland, permits might be required depending on local council regulations concerning construction work; it’s best practice to check ahead!
Will my homeowners’ insurance cover the costs?
Many policies do include coverage for roof replacement under specific circumstances like storm damage; always consult with your insurance provider.
